1 Kings 22:34 - Good News Bible (Catholic edition in Septuagint order)

By chance, however, a Syrian soldier shot an arrow which struck King Ahab between the joints of his armour. “I'm wounded!” he cried out to his chariot driver. “Turn round and pull out of the battle!”
